DALLAS (TheStreet) -- Bankrupt AMR (AAMRQ.PK) says it will reduce annual costs by more than $2 billion in its Chapter 11 reorganization -- eliminating about 13,000 jobs -- while increasing flying by 20% and annual revenue by $1 billion.

The proposed job cuts, which were scheduled to be outlined to employees on Wednesday, would include 4,600 mechanics and related workers; 4,200 fleet service and other Transport Workers Union members; 2,300 flight attendants; 1,400 management and support staff workers; 400 pilots; and a still undetermined number of agents, customer service representatives and planners, the carrier said.
